Do I need a smart meter installed?
I have switched my gas and electricity to British Gas (Energy Plus Protection Green Sep 2020 v2) via the Cheap Energy Club in September and was wondering if the plan requires me to have a smart meter installed or can I keep my current meters and just provide them the readings?

The specific Ts & Cs for your tariff mean that you need to book a smart meter installation appointment within 3 months and be at home for the appointment.
It goes on to say "If we can’t install smart meters at your home, you can stay on this tariff, but you’ll need to send us meter readings when prompted and manage your account online. If you are eligible for smart meters, and don’t already have them and don’t book an appointment for installation (where you are at the appointment or arrange for an alternative person to be at the appointment) within 3 months of coming on supply or switching to this tariff, we may contact you and give you 30 days to choose a different tariff. If you don’t choose a different tariff or don’t book a smart meter appointment after we have contacted you, we’ll switch your tariff to a similar tariff (which doesn’t require a smart meter) which we have available for you at the time.
So if you're feeling bold you could call their bluff by arranging an appointment but then declining permission for the technician to install the smart meters !

If you refuse permission to the meter engineer on the day, it would be closed down as refused smart, not that it cant be done.0
